Smith Calls Pierce 'Bitter, Doesn't Know What New York Is About'

Aug 31, 2013 3:06 PM

Paul Pierce sparked a war of words between the Brooklyn Nets and New York Knicks, and J.R. Smith was the latest to respond to the former Boston Celtics star's comments that the Nets will soon own New York.

"I just look at him as a bitter person just getting out of Boston. He doesn't really know what New York is all about. He's been playing in Boston his whole career," Smith said.

"He just knows, just know that his words have consequences and he's going to have to pay for them."

Smith is hoping to be healthy for the start of training camp.

Ivan Johnson Signs One-Year Contract With China's Golden Bulls

Aug 29, 2013 10:29 AM

With no NBA out clause, Ivan Johnson has signed a one-year contract with the Zhejiang Golden Bulls of the Chinese Basketball Association, a league source told RealGM.

Johnson, the 6-foot-8 free agent forward, received interest throughout NBA free agency, and his four finalists were the Los Angeles Clippers, New York Knicks, Indiana Pacers and Chicago Bulls, a source said. He decided to accept a more lucrative deal in China – where he spent the 2011 season – instead of continuing to wait for an organization to enhance its offer.

Johnson also is hoping to take advantage of China’s shorter season and return to the States late in the NBA season, when teams will deal with possible injuries and look to add pieces.

There remains strong interest in Johnson, and the 29-year-old took a deal for one season in order to return next year. RealGM first reported on Aug. 16 that Johnson had started to seriously consider leaving the NBA for offers in China and Italy.

Johnson averaged 6.5 points and 3.9 rebounds over two seasons with the Atlanta Hawks, carving a role as an active, tough big man after bouncing around in his basketball career.

Dean Meminger Passes At 65

Aug 23, 2013 11:37 PM

Dean Meminger, who played for the New York Knicks' championship team in 1973, passed away at the age of 65.

Meminger was found in a hotel room in Upper Manhattan. The cause of death is under investigation but there were no signs of trauma.

Meminger had long battled an addiction to cocaine and had acknowledged using drugs during his NBA career.

Meminger was the Knicks' first round pick in 1971.

Meminger joined other members of the 1973 Knicks team for a ceremony at the Garden on April 5. “There was no one prouder than Dean to be back on the court with his teammates,” Glen Grunwald, the Knicks’ general manager, said in a statement.

Knicks, Nets Could Soon Be Named 2015 All-Star Weekend Co-Hosts

Aug 23, 2013 1:23 PM

The NBA continues to be in discussions with Madison Square Garden and Barclays Center on hosting All-Star Weekend in 2015.

A decision is expected to be reached in September.

The New York Knicks and Brooklyn Nets would co-host the weekend, with MSG hosting Sunday's game and Barclays hosting events on Friday and Saturday.

“It hasn't been finalized,” one source said Thursday night.

The event could return to New York before 2020 with the venues flipping hosting duties.

Felton Has Lost 15 Pounds Since End Of Season

Aug 19, 2013 10:32 AM

Raymond Felton has lost 15 pounds since the end of the New York Knicks' season.

Felton played at approximately 212 pounds last season and is encouraged by his new physique.

"I was quick before, but if you take off 15 pounds, you can be that much quicker," Felton said Sunday.

Felton was out of weight and not physically prepared for the season to start after the lockout in 2011 when he joined the Portland Trail Blazers.

Felton is working with trainer Keith Veney.
